Whenever I’m shopping online, one of the biggest things I look at when learning about new products is what other people think about it. Best Buy carries many different types of laptops many with similar specs, but what interests me most is how it will perform once a get it home and put it through the paces.

As we’ve been developing the QuickPark site over the past few months, one thing that stuck out in my mind was a need for way for our users to leave feedback about the hundreds of parking locations listed on our site. While this may seem like an easy problem to fix, it is actually quite complicated to design a review system that actually means something. Recently I was reading an article about the complications YouTube has faced with their video rating system, everyone always votes either 5 stars or 1 star. Alternatively you have the Digg system whether people either like or dislike content. After giving it some thought I came up with what is now our user review system.
